Limited Competition: Centers of Biomedical Research Excellence (COBRE) (Phase 3) - Transitional Centers (P30 Clinical Trial Optional)

The purpose of this Notice of Funding Opportunity (NOFO) is to transition the core resources and biomedical research activities of Centers of Biomedical Research Excellence (COBRE) into independence and sustainability.

Additional Information of Eligibility:
Other Eligible Applicants include the following: Non-domestic (non-U.S.) Entities (Foreign Institutions) are not eligible to apply.

Non-domestic (non-U.S.) components of U. S. Organizations are not eligible to apply.

Foreign components, as defined in the NIH Grants Policy Statement, are not allowed.
